Abducted Lagos School Girls Back in School for Classes (Photo)

Posted by George on Mon 07th Mar, 2016 - tori.ng

The school girls who were rescued from kidnappers in Lagos over the weekend have returned to school for normal educative activities.

The three girls in school today
 
Babington Macaulay Junior Seminary School in the Ikorodu area of Lagos has been in the news for unprecedented reasons after three female students were abducted by assailants demanding for N60 million on the whole for the children before being arrested by men of the Nigerian police.
 
 
The rescued girls have been re-integrated into the school system as normalcy returns to the school.
 
CSP. Abba Kyari who led the Special Intelligence Response Team (SIRT) of the Lagos state Police command, that rescued the 3 abducted school girls in Ikorodu yesterday March 6th, met with Lagos state governor, Akinwunmi Ambode who expressed his gratitude after the rescue operation.
